Rev. Frederick William 
MacDonald
, Methodist minister. He bacme president of the Wesleyan Mthodist Conference. Issue - 4 daughters who all had Anglican weddings.

Born: Leeds, Yorkshire, England 25th Feb 1842 Baptised:
Died: 1928Buried:
